Alex Ovechkin is approaching history, and now the NHL have revealed their plans to celebrate it, but fans aren't happy with the plans that they've made.
After his goal on Wednesday night against the Carolina Hurricanes, the Washington Capitals captain now finds himself just three goals away from passing Wayne Gretzky for No. 1 in NHL history.
With seven games remaining in the Capitals season, the believe is that after 39 goals on the season, he's more likely than not to do it this year, with fans and the league eagerly anticipating the history making moment.
Now it's been revealed how the NHL plan on celebrating the moment, with reports revealing that the league have limited Ovechkin's on-ice celebration to just 7 minutes, with many noting that while that's too short in general, 8 minutes would have been much more appropriate unless he's going to be known as The Great 7 moving forward.
Given that he's not just making season history or an irrelevant statistic, but rather passing arguably the greatest player all time in the NHL record in goals, many believed it would be a much longer celebration to recap the incredible run that
Ovechkin has been on throughout his Capitals career, with fans calling out the NHL's major decision.
With so many people wanting to pay tribute to Ovechkin and the incredible support he's received, it's safe to say that many believe the celebration should reflect the moment, and with no one close to catching Ovechkin that's currently active, it's one that's likely to stand for a long time.
Ultimately though, whatever celebration there is for Ovechkin will be much appreciated by The Great 8, who has been fantastic this season even with all of the attention on his record chase, and with the team having the chance to honour him after the on-ice celebration, it's safe to say we'll see plenty more than just those 7 minutes.
